What Are Window Gasket Seals?
A window gasket seal is a flexible material used to seal the gaps in between a window frame and the window itself. Typically made from rubber, silicone, or vinyl, these gaskets are created to avoid air, water, and dust from going into a structure through the window assembly. They provide cushioning, reduce vibrations, and help safeguard the window from external aspects.

Common Types of Window Gasket Seals
Compression Seals: These seals compress when the window is closed, producing a tight bond that prevents air leakages.

Bulb Seals: These seals include a rounded bulb shape that compresses versus the window frame, providing excellent insulation.

Foam Seals: Made from foam products, these seals are soft and can fill irregular gaps successfully.

Magnetic Seals: Utilizing magnets to preserve a tight close, these are normally found in storm windows and double-glazed panels.

Flat Gaskets: Simple and simple, these seals lie flat versus the window frame. They are typical in commercial applications where visual appeals are paramount.

Upkeep Tips for Window Gasket Seals
Appropriate upkeep of window [Gasket Seal Replacement](https://pad.stuve.de/KXYU1zfGRJyzGa7mn19wXQ/) seals can extend their life-span and guarantee they work optimally.

Routine Inspection: Check seals each year for noticeable indications of wear, cracks, or mold.

Cleaning up: Use moderate soap and water to clean up the seals, getting rid of dirt and debris that might impair their function.

Lubrication: If appropriate, use a silicone lube to keep [Door Seals](http://www.qianqi.cloud/home.php?mod=space&uid=960660) versatile and complimentary from sticking.

Immediate Replacement: If you see any damage, replace the gasket right away to guarantee energy efficiency is maintained.

Expert Help: For complex window systems, think about hiring specialists for installation and maintenance.

Q1: How do I know if my window gaskets require replacement?A1: Signs consist of visible fractures, trouble opening or closing windows, drafts, and increased energy costs. Routine examinations can assist determine these problems early. Q2: Can I change window gaskets myself?A2: Yes, with the right tools
and understanding of your window type, you can change
gaskets. However, for high-end or complicated systems, expert help is advisable. Q3: How long do window gaskets last?A3: The lifespan of window gasket seals varies by material and ecological conditions however generally ranges from 5 to 20 years. Q4: What are the expenses connected with replacing window gaskets?A4: Costs depend upon the type of gasket, size of the window, and whether you work with a professional. DIY replacements can be more affordable, while expert services may cost more. Q5:
Are there energy-efficient gasket choices available?A5: Yes, many makers use energy-efficient gasket seals designed with thermal insulation residential or commercial properties, which can enhance energy performance.
